In August 2025, Roskomnadzor had imposed restrictions on calls on Telegram, citing its efforts to combat criminal activity through the application. In February 2026, citizens in Russia began to complain about problems in the application’s operation, and on February 10, Roskomnadzor announced that Telegram had not taken effective measures to combat fraud on its platforms, did not protect users’ personal data, and violated Russian laws. The authority promised to impose “gradual restrictions” to change This situation.
For his part, Anton Nemkin, a member of the Information Policy Committee in the Russian State Duma, stated that the restrictions imposed by Russia on the “Telegram” platform are not aimed at banning, but rather to force the platform to comply with Russian law. He said: “If the platform decides to work in accordance with the requirements of Russian legislation and ensures the appropriate level of protection for citizens, there will be no fundamental obstacles to restoring full operation.”
